Halitron, Inc Beats $350,000 Forecast for the First Quarter of 2018


Gross profit up and increasing margins and cash flows for the reminder of the year

NEWTOWN, CT, May 16, 2018 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Halitron, Inc. (the “Company,” “Halitron”) (OTC: HAON), a multisector holding company, is pleased to announce the financial results for the quarter ending March 31, 2018. Below is a list of financial and operational updates:

The operating and financial performance of the Company during the first quarter was very efficient and within budget.  Seamlessly operating the day-to-day order flow and, at the same time, relocating an entire 5,000 square foot factory was very impressive.  Management will now focus on sales growth initiatives over the next few quarters including developing the relationship with the recently awarded 425+ full-chain point of purchase supplies project.

About Halitron, Inc.

Halitron, Inc. is focused on acquiring sales, marketing, and manufacturing businesses to roll into efficient, low-cost operating infrastructures. Management targets operating entities that can benefit from our current operating infrastructure or operate autonomously and utilize our  product or service offerings in order to expand their existing operations.
